Residual Energy Monitoring Method for Wireless Sensor Networks Based on Time Series

  • In order to analyze the energy consumption of packet nodes and accurately monitor the residual energy of wireless sensor network nodes, a time series-based method for monitoring the residual energy of nodes is proposed. The ARMA time series analysis model is constructed, which is used to fuse the wireless sensor network data. The cluster head is selected by the principle of energy priority. The cluster head uses the multi-hop method to transmit the fused data, and obtains the best energy consumption path from the cluster head to the base station; The energy consumption of cluster head nodes from sleep to restart is not considered. The energy consumption of wireless sensor network information transmission and the energy consumption of cluster head nodes when changing their own state are calculated. Only the energy consumption of network nodes in the process of transmitting fusion information under normal conditions is monitored, and the residual energy of wireless sensor network nodes is monitored. Experiments show that this method can effectively fuse the data in the network, and can realize the real-time, intuitive and accurate monitoring of the residual energy of wireless sensor network nodes.
